Using the Advanced Search to combine terms.Accessing the Knowledge and Library Hub.The session will look at basic Literature Searching using the NHS Knowledge and Library Hub. This event is for any Primary Care staff in Nottingham or Notts, especially those undertaking academic courses and requiring a refresher in Literature Searching to support their assignments. This teaching session will focus on finding journal articles on a particular subject, to support your clinical practice and/or academic assignment Target Audience This is event is for staff working in Primary Care in Nottingham & Nottinghamshire Aim of this Event
